Output 444818d09df1d7f0c7e06bff60a961440e9bafb378c77b84f439e7866a4065a7:2

value
2913574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863b67d4f83c7db6d43daa438c8e344319c1f1d2 OP_EQUAL
address
3DvmdpdXtFEpfRNUu6yr5aMydjxho5ueJx
transaction
444818d09df1d7f0c7e06bff60a961440e9bafb378c77b84f439e7866a4065a7
confirmations
332422
spent
true